Transaction 64c5e89e48ec356413b2899c7236efb31bb201d0a76b89b2f8f68fe87e59dab2

2 Input
2 Outputs
  • 64c5e89e48ec356413b2899c7236efb31bb201d0a76b89b2f8f68fe87e59dab2:0
  • value  3112967
    address  3PB6Zo6T6sRCLFEyhSwe7C1AiPz19VasYn
  • 64c5e89e48ec356413b2899c7236efb31bb201d0a76b89b2f8f68fe87e59dab2:1
  • value  98296000
    address  bc1qd06ty83v26ungcesqj2kz6xa7n0a42n8j29gvn